Cubs beat the Cardinals in 11 innings for their 10th straight win

Anthony Rizzo drew a bases-loaded walk for the walk-off run as the Cubs clipped the Cardinals 4-3 in 11 innings at Wrigley Field. Chris Coghlan nailed a two-run single for the Cubs, who ran their win streak to 10 games. Jon Lester pitched six innings in a no-decision. Mike Montgomery earned the win in relief.

Randall Grichuk belted the tying home run for the Cardinals in the seventh inning. Brandon Moss also went long for St. Louis. Zach Duke took the loss after issuing the walk.

Game 2 of the series is this afternoon at Wrigley Field.
